Recent research on alcohol use among LGB young adults indicates that sexual minority youth are at increased risk relative to their heterosexual peers. One possible contributing factor is that religiosity fails to provide the significant protection for LGB youth that it has been demonstrated to provide in general population samples. Although recent studies provide some support for this hypothesis, there is little research seeking to understand the reasons that religiosity may fail to protect against heavy drinking among LGB youth. The current study attempted to address this gap by examining relations among religiosity, age of self-identification, and alcohol use in a sample of 103 young adults self identified as lesbian, gay, or bisexual. Using multiple regression, we found that religiosity had an indirect effect on alcohol use operating through age of identification as LGB. Higher religiosity was associated with a later age of self-identification, which in turn, predicted greater increases in alcohol use among LGB youth during the transition from high school through college. Exploratory analyses found that gender significantly moderated the influence of age of self-identification on alcohol use such that a later age of self-identification was a risk factor for increased drinking for women, but not for men. The findings have important implications for understanding complex relations between religiosity and alcohol use among LGB youth. In addition, the findings may inform the development of religious support groups for LGB youth that will allow them to experience the benefits of religious involvement that heterosexual youth experience.

Humans require sufficient social understanding and connectedness to thrive (Baumeister & Leary, 1995). The current study evaluates the effectiveness of the Social Intelligence Institute's training program pilot. At a middle school in Phoenix, Arizona, students in a 7th and 8th grade class participated in this pilot program during the spring of 2013. Pre- and post-test questionnaires administered indicated changes in participants reported measures of Perspective Taking, Empathetic Concern, Interpersonal Expectations, and Relationship Self-Efficacy. The program consists of seven modules, each with several sessions, including instructional videos with reflection questions and class discussions. It was predicted that there would be a significant increase in mean scores for the dependent variables in the questionnaire mentioned above from the pre-test to the post-test. However, the null hypotheses were not rejected; statistical significance in t-tests of the measured variables were not met. Yet, the program was more effective for 8th graders than for 7th graders for Perspective Taking. This study of the SI pilot program demonstrates areas of improvement and provides support for wider implementation in the future.

This study examined the relation between Religiosity (a motivational system) and Working Memory Capacity (a cognitive system) to determine how they interact to promote goal-directed behavior. Participants completed a religiosity questionnaire and engaged in a battery of tasks that were used to assess their Working Memory Capacity (WMC) and overall ability to maintain goal-directed behavior. The Stroop task was used to examine the participants' ability to maintain goals in the face of interference. It was predicted that religiosity and WMC would be inversely related and that when we controlled for religiosity, WMC would be the only significant predictor of Stroop performance. Furthermore, we hypothesized that religiosity and Stoop would be inversely related, whereas WMC and Stroop would be positively correlated with one another. Religiosity and Stroop performance were each divided into three different components. Religiosity was divided into: Intrinsic Motivation, Extrinsic Motivation, and CARMA. Stroop Performance was measured through Stroop Accuracy, the Stroop Effect, and Post-Error Slowing. The results of our study supported each of our hypotheses. These findings demonstrated that there is a cognitive process underlying motivational systems, such as religion, which affect an individual's ability to sustain goal-directed behavior.

Increasing vegetable consumption among the adult population is a major goal, as the health benefits of vegetables can decrease one's risk of heart disease, cancer, diabetes, and obesity. The current study examined a potential strategy to increase consumption of vegetables by pairing them with a dip and a TV distraction. Based upon results of previous, similar research studies (Blass et al., 2006; Fisher et al., 2012; Johnston et al., 2012; Mittal, Stevenson, Oaten, & Miller, 2011), we hypothesized that eating vegetables with dip or while distracted with a television sitcom would result in increased consumption. We also hypothesized that both dip and a distraction together will synergistically increase vegetable consumption. A total of 126 college students were assigned to one of four conditions: eating vegetables with dip, with dip and a television distractor, with only a television distractor, or without either dip or a television distractor. While television had no significant influence on vegetable consumption, pairing vegetables with a dip significantly increased consumption of vegetables. Pairing vegetables with a dip may prove to be an effective strategy for increasing vegetable intake in the adult population.

This project, which consists of a review article and an applied creative project, proposes mirror neurons as being a physiological mechanism for motor imagery. The review article highlights similarities between motor imagery research and research on mirror neurons. The research is roughly divided into three types of studies: neuroimaging studies, transcranial magnetic stimulation (TMS) and electromyography (EMG) studies, and electroencephalography (EEG) studies. The review also discusses the associative hypothesis of mirror neuron origin as support for the hypothesis and concludes with an assessment of conflicting research and the limitations of the hypothesis. The applied creative project is an instructional brochure, aimed at anyone who teaches motor skills, such as dance teachers or sports coaches. The brochure takes the academic content of the review and presents it in a visually pleasing, reader-friendly fashion in an effort to educate the intended audience and make the research more accessible. The brochure also prescribes research-based suggestions for how to use motor imagery during teaching sessions and how to get the best benefits from it.

This thesis presents a gas sensor readout IC for amperometric and conductometric electrochemical sensors. The Analog Front-End (AFE) readout circuit enables tracking long term exposure to hazardous gas fumes in diesel and gasoline equipments, which may be correlated to diseases. Thus, the detection and discrimination of gases using microelectronic gas sensor system is required. This thesis describes the research, development, implementation and test of a small and portable based prototype platform for chemical gas sensors to enable a low-power and low noise gas detection system. The AFE reads out the outputs of eight conductometric sensor array and eight amperometric sensor arrays. The IC consists of a low noise potentiostat, and associated 9bit current-steering DAC for sensor stimulus, followed by the first order nested chopped £U£G ADC. The conductometric sensor uses a current driven approach for extracting conductance of the sensor depending on gas concentration. The amperometric sensor uses a potentiostat to apply constant voltage to the sensors and an I/V converter to measure current out of the sensor. The core area for the AFE is 2.65x0.95 mm2. The proposed system achieves 91 dB SNR at 1.32 mW quiescent power consumption per channel. With digital offset storage and nested chopping, the readout chain achieves 500 fÝV input referred offset.

Distributed inference has applications in fields as varied as source localization, evaluation of network quality, and remote monitoring of wildlife habitats. In this dissertation, distributed inference algorithms over multiple-access channels are considered. The performance of these algorithms and the effects of wireless communication channels on the performance are studied. In a first class of problems, distributed inference over fading Gaussian multiple-access channels with amplify-and-forward is considered. Sensors observe a phenomenon and transmit their observations using the amplify-and-forward scheme to a fusion center (FC). Distributed estimation is considered with a single antenna at the FC, where the performance is evaluated using the asymptotic variance of the estimator. The loss in performance due to varying assumptions on the limited amounts of channel information at the sensors is quantified. With multiple antennas at the FC, a distributed detection problem is also considered, where the error exponent is used to evaluate performance. It is shown that for zero-mean channels between the sensors and the FC when there is no channel information at the sensors, arbitrarily large gains in the error exponent can be obtained with sufficient increase in the number of antennas at the FC. In stark contrast, when there is channel information at the sensors, the gain in error exponent due to having multiple antennas at the FC is shown to be no more than a factor of 8/π for Rayleigh fading channels between the sensors and the FC, independent of the number of antennas at the FC, or correlation among noise samples across sensors. In a second class of problems, sensor observations are transmitted to the FC using constant-modulus phase modulation over Gaussian multiple-access-channels. The phase modulation scheme allows for constant transmit power and estimation of moments other than the mean with a single transmission from the sensors. Estimators are developed for the mean, variance and signal-to-noise ratio (SNR) of the sensor observations. The performance of these estimators is studied for different distributions of the observations. It is proved that the estimator of the mean is asymptotically efficient if and only if the distribution of the sensor observations is Gaussian.

Childhood obesity is a societal cost that affects children across the world. Although childhood obesity affects children of various ethnic backgrounds, childhood obesity is disproportionately prevalent in lower income, minority households. Current interventions for childhood obesity center around a “one size fits all” model that is poor in efficacy amongst minority populations. However, through the examination of parent feeding strategies, the efficacy of interventions may increase. This literature review wishes to examine the role of parent feeding strategies as an indicator of childhood obesity and to examine whether there is an association between parent feeding strategies, child unhealthy eating, weight status, and ethnicity. An examination of the literature on childhood obesity, suggests that childhood obesity can be attributed to genetic, social, and environmental influences. Research has indicated that having parents who exhibit the indulgent feeding style are more strongly associated with child unhealthy eating when compared to other feeding styles. Given this literature review, I predict that the association between indulgent feeding style and child unhealthy eating is stronger among overweight/obese children than normal weight children. Lastly, I conclude that the association of indulgent feeding styles, child unhealthy eating, and child weight status will be more strongly associated amongst Latinx households when compared to African American and White households.

Recent findings support that facial musculature accounts for a form of phonetic sound symbolism. Yu, McBeath, and Glenberg (2019) found that, in both English words and Mandarin pinyin, words with the middle phoneme /i:/ (as in “gleam”) were rated as more positive than their paired words containing the phoneme /ʌ/ (as in “glum”). The present study tested whether a second largely orthogonal dimension of vowel phoneme production (represented by the phonemes /æ/ vs /u/), is related to a second dimension perpendicular to emotional valence, arousal. Arousal was chosen because it is the second dimension of the Russell Circumplex Model of Affect. In phonetic similarity mappings, this second dimension is typically characterized by oral aperture size and larynx position, but it also appears to follow the continuum of consonance/dissonance. Our findings supported the hypothesis that one-syllable words with the center vowel phoneme /æ/ were reliably rated as more rousing, and less calming, than matched words with the center vowel phoneme /u/. These results extend the Yu, et al. findings regarding the potential contribution of facial musculature to sounds associated with the emotional dimension of arousal, and further confirm a model of sound symbolism related to emotional expression. These findings support that phonemes are not neutral basic units but rather illustrate an innate relationship between embodied emotional expression and speech production.

Accurately assessing the sexual interest of others is useful for initiating courtship behaviors that have a chance of being reciprocated, and also potentially critical for survival, particularly for women, where unwanted sexual interest from men can become unwanted sexual advances, sexual assault, and worse. Previous research suggests that men overestimate women’s sexual interest to initiate courtship behaviors even if the probability of their advances being reciprocated is low. This may be because missing a potential mating opportunity is costlier than squandered courtship efforts. However, research on this male sexual overestimation effect has failed to fully appreciate the importance of the motivations and contexts of actors. Here, we primed participants with short-term mating motivations and threat contexts to compare against a control prime condition. We replicated the male sexual overestimation effect in the control and threat prime conditions and found a marginal effect in the short-term mating prime condition. The magnitude of the difference between men’s estimations and women’s self-reports of women’s sexual interest was only significantly different from the control prime in the threat condition. Additionally, we explored some interesting combinations of circumstances. We found that, in a potentially common scenario, where men are primed with short-term mating motives and women are primed with threat, the male sexual overestimation effect replicates and, further, find that this effect disappears when the mindsets of men and women are reversed. We discuss the implications of these findings in the context of understanding what the default psychologies of people during the early stages of courtship are, and the effects these psychologies have on estimations of sexual interest.
